Ewell, Maryland, is a small but vibrant unincorporated community on Smith Island, known for its natural beauty and close-knit community. In this serene environment, residents may find themselves facing mental health challenges which can be compounded by the remote nature of the area. Virtual Intensive Outpatient Programs (IOP) provide essential support through online platforms, making it easier for local individuals to access therapy without the need to travel.

For Ewell residents, Virtual IOP offers a range of benefits tailored to their unique needs. With structured therapy sessions that can be attended from the comfort of home, individuals can maintain their work, school, and family obligations while receiving crucial mental health support. Offering flexibility and a wide array of evidence-based treatment options, this program is designed to fit seamlessly into daily life.

Getting started with a Virtual IOP is simple and straightforward. Most programs involve 9-20 hours of therapy each week, with sessions typically held 3-5 days a week. You will engage with licensed therapists through HIPAA-compliant video conferencing, ensuring privacy and confidentiality. Compass Health Center - Compass Virtual PHP/IOP

Mental Health & Substance Use
Regional Coverage
Adolescents (13–18), young adults (18–23), and adults (23+) — separate age-specific virtual programs
877-552-6672

Provides both Intensive Outpatient and Partial Hospitalization levels of care virtually. Highly specialized programs including School Anxiety/Refusal, OCD & Complex Anxiety, Trauma-focused IOPs, and even programs addressing chronic pain with mental health. Known for short-term, outcomes-focused care with multidisciplinary teams. Patients participate in structured group therapy daily via Compass Virtual, with additional family support and psychiatric services as needed. Offers an after-school Intensive Outpatient Program for teens (attend school by day, therapy in late afternoon), and an evening IOP for adults (“after work” 5-8pm CST) to accommodate daily schedules. Emphasizes evidence-based group therapy (CBT, DBT, ACT) with regular psychiatry consults and family therapy integration. Must be physically located in IL, MD, VA, or WI during sessions; expanding to additional states soon. Outcomes comparable to in-person, with high patient satisfaction.

SunCloud Health Virtual Evening IOP

Mental Health & Substance Use
Regional Coverage
Adults (18+; all genders, including working adults who require evening treatment)
866-729-1012

Intensive evening schedule (3 hours per day, Mon–Fri 5:30–8:30pm CT) allows clients to maintain work or school while in treatment. Uses SunCloud’s integrated treatment model to address substance use, eating disorders, mood disorders, and trauma together in one program. Virtual programming includes process groups, DBT skills training, individual therapy, and supported meals (for those with eating disorders). Accredited by The Joint Commission (Gold Seal) for high-quality care.
